WebEsketamine, like ketamine, has the potential to distort your perception during the first two hours after treatment, so it has to be administered in a clinic setting. Treatment for esketamine nasal spray is done on an outpatient basis. With the nasal spray, you give yourself three doses, spaced five minutes apart, under doctor supervision. WebJan 13, 2024 · Afrin addiction can have potential side effects. It can cause thickening of the nose walls which is known as turbinate hypertrophy. It can lead to blocking of the nose and ultimately congestion.
